I have taken my cars to Randy's a few times. Twice for repairs and once to get new tires. I don't know anything about cars but they always got the job done on time and correctly. I did have to wait a while to get someone to sell me my tires but they had fair prices and were able to put them on for me right away. They also have a waiting area with a tv and free popcorn which was nice for my little girl who was with me.